The Crucial First Hours: Tattoo Aftercare First Day and the Value of the Bandage
The trip to a perfectly healed tattoo starts the moment your artist finishes their work. The tattoo aftercare bandage they use is your tattoo's first line of defense versus bacteria and outside toxic irritants. This preliminary security is important, specifically during the vulnerable tattoo aftercare very first day.

Pay attention to Your Musician's Instructions: Your tattoo artist is your primary resource of info. They will certainly offer specific instructions based upon your tattoo, the techniques utilized, and your skin type. Always prioritize their guidance.
The Period of the Bandage: Typically, your musician will suggest leaving the bandage on for a minimum of 2-6 hours, and sometimes longer relying on the size and location of your tattoo, in addition to the sort of bandage used (e.g., Saniderm or traditional cling movie).
Why the Bandage Matters: This first covering shields the open injury from air-borne microorganisms and avoids it from scrubing against clothes or other surface areas, which can trigger inflammation and increase the threat of infection.
Eliminating the Plaster Securely: Once the recommended time has actually passed, it's crucial to get rid of the bandage thoroughly. Laundry your hands extensively with soap and water prior to continuing. Delicately peel the bandage away, preferably in the direction of hair growth. Avoid ripping or tearing it off, as this can aggravate the skin. If the bandage sticks, moisten it somewhat with warm water.
The Necessary Tattoo Aftercare Routine: Weeks of Nurturing.
After eliminating the first plaster, your committed tattoo aftercare regular begins. This regular care over the following couple of weeks is crucial for proper recovery.

Gentle Cleansing:.

Promptly after eliminating the plaster, carefully wash your tattoo with light, fragrance-free soap and lukewarm water. Use your tidy fingertips to cleanse the area, preventing extreme scrubbing up or making use of washcloths or sponges, which can be unpleasant.
Wash extensively with warm water to eliminate all traces of soap.
Rub the tattoo completely dry with a tidy paper towel. Stay clear of making use of fabric towels, which can harbor microorganisms.
Moisturization is Secret (But Less is Extra):.

When the tattoo is totally dry, use a very thin layer of a advised tattoo aftercare lotion or balm. Popular options consist of fragrance-free choices like Aquaphor, or specialized tattoo balms made with all-natural components.
The trick below is a thin layer. Too much lotion can catch wetness and microorganisms, preventing recovery and potentially leading to outbreaks. Your tattoo needs to take a breath. The ointment needs to just be enough to keep the area from drying and fracturing.
Repeat the washing and moisturizing process 2-3 times a day for the first two weeks, or as advised by your musician.
Let it Take a breath:.

After the first bandage is gotten rid of, stay clear of re-bandaging your tattoo unless specifically instructed by your musician ( for instance, if your work environment presents a high risk of contamination). Permitting the tattoo to be exposed to air promotes healing.
What to Definitely Avoid During the Tattoo Healing Refine.
Successful tattoo healing includes more than just what you ought to do; it likewise needs knowing what to prevent.

Soaking: Absolutely avoid saturating your tattoo in bathrooms, pool, hot tubs, lakes, or any standing water for a minimum of two weeks. Soaking introduces a high danger of infection and can create the ink to leach out.
Direct Sunlight: Straight sun exposure is damaging to a new tattoo. It can create fading, scorching, and increase the danger of scarring. Wear loose, safety garments over your tattoo when you're outdoors. As soon as the first recovery phase is total (no open skin or scabbing), you can utilize a fragrance-free, high SPF sun block specifically developed for sensitive skin.
Choosing and Scraping: Itching is a normal part of the healing procedure as the skin restores. However, stand up to the overwhelming urge to pick or scratch at scabs. Doing so can bring about infection, scarring, and loss of ink, jeopardizing the final appearance of your tattoo. Allow scabs diminish naturally.
Limited Apparel: Avoid wearing tight or restrictive clothing over your brand-new tattoo. This can cause irritation, rub against the recovery skin, and limit air movement, impeding the recovery process. Opt for loosened, breathable fabrics.
Harsh Soaps and Lotions: Adhere to mild, fragrance-free soaps and the aftercare ointment suggested by your musician. Stay clear of items having rough chemicals, fragrances, dyes, or exfoliants, as these can aggravate the sensitive healing skin.

Comprehending the Healing Stages.
The tattoo healing procedure generally unravels in stages:.

Day 1-3: The tattoo will likely be red, puffy, and might really feel tender or bruised. This is typical swelling.
Day 4-7: The inflammation and swelling ought to start to go away. You'll likely observe the development of scabs. Itching may start throughout this phase.
Week 2: The scabs will begin to exfoliate. It's vital not to pick at them. The tattoo might appear over cast or dull during this phase as a brand-new layer of skin types.
Weeks 3-4: The scabbing ought to be full, and the color tattoo aftercare instructions of your tattoo will start to come to be extra dynamic. The new skin might still look somewhat shiny.
Months 1-6: While the surface area might appear healed within a couple of weeks, the deeper layers of skin remain to heal for several months. Continue to protect your tattoo from straight sunlight to preserve its vibrancy.
Long-Term Tattoo Treatment: Maintaining Your Art.
When your tattoo is totally healed, developing a lasting treatment routine will assist keep it looking its ideal:.

Sun Defense: Regular use of a high SPF, fragrance-free sun block is essential for stopping fading and keeping the vibrancy of your tattoo, especially during long term sunlight exposure.
Moisturization: Routinely hydrating your tattoo with a fragrance-free cream can help keep the skin moistened and the shades looking fresh.
Stay Clear Of Harsh Chemicals: Be mindful of harsh chemicals in cleaning products or skincare that might enter contact with your tattoo.
When to Look For Expert Recommendations.
While the majority of tattoos heal without problems, it's necessary to know the indicators of infection or other problems:.

Increased redness or swelling beyond the preliminary couple of days.
Too much discomfort or inflammation.
Pus or any kind of type of discharge from the tattoo.
High temperature.
Warm to the touch skin around the tattoo.
If you experience any of these signs, get in touch with a medical professional instantly. Your tattoo musician can additionally provide advice and help you distinguish between regular recovery and possible issues.
